Symbols
Blaster the burro symbolizes the dedication, hard work and dedication Orediggers are known for. He was first introduced to Mines football games by Frederick Foss in the mid-20th century, and has since evolved into a beloved symbol of the university. Today, Blaster is a presence at all Mines sporting events and has been made the official symbol of the engineering school.

Each spring, Mines students put their studies aside to celebrate what it means to be an oredigger at the three-day Engineering Days (E-Days) celebration. The annual event includes a cardboard boat race down Clear Creek and an ore-cart pull to the State Capitol Building in Colorado A drilling contest, engineering games and a sunrise M Climb and awards. The event showcases the multidisciplinary approach Mines students employ to solve real-world engineering challenges and prepare them for career opportunities in the field.
Rules
The game's simple rules make it an excellent choice for players of all levels. The player begins by selecting one of the squares from a grid of tiles that contain hidden mines. If the tile is a hidden mine it will explode, and then end the game. Otherwise it will show an amount that indicates how many mines are located in the adjacent tiles. To get rid of the board, players must mark all mines using flags.
